在設(shè)置使用windows 2000 Server服務(wù)的時(shí)候,維護(hù)工作是非常重要的。下面就和大家交流一下維護(hù)和排除DNS故障的方法。
一、使用Dnscmd方便維護(hù)DNS系統(tǒng)
與UNIX或腳本命令類似,Windows 2000的資源工具包提供了一個(gè)叫做Dnscmd的命令行程序,它用來治理DNS服務(wù)器。
該工具可用于不同任務(wù):
1.創(chuàng)建腳本或批處理文件,使DNS中每日的治理進(jìn)程自動(dòng)化。它非凡適合設(shè)置使用文本文件的標(biāo)準(zhǔn)DNS主要區(qū)域的情況。
2.更新資源記錄。
3. 建立并配置新的DNS服務(wù)器。
Dnscmd的安裝很簡單:
1.將Dnscmd文件從Win 2000 Server CD-ROM光盤的/support/enterPRise/reskit文件夾復(fù)制到DNS服務(wù)器中你選擇的文件夾中即可。如c/winnt/system32/dns文件夾下。注重,Win 2000 Professional光盤中不存在這個(gè)程序。
2.在“運(yùn)行”菜單或命令行提示符上鍵入DNSCMD或加上不同參數(shù)進(jìn)行維護(hù)工作。
二、用好Ping命令
相信大家對Ping命令都比較熟悉,它使用ICMP協(xié)議檢查網(wǎng)絡(luò)上特定ip地址的存在,一個(gè)DNS域名也是對應(yīng)一個(gè)IP地址的,因此下面的命令可以檢查一個(gè)DNS域名的連通性:
Ping www.kwsOffice.com
假如一客戶端不能解析DNS域名,使用上述命令可以判定該客戶端與DNS服務(wù)器的連通性。然后可以再Ping網(wǎng)絡(luò)中的其它客戶端。假如都Ping不通,說明該客戶端有問題,假如后者可以Ping通,則說明DNS配置錯(cuò)誤或DNS服務(wù)器錯(cuò)誤。
三、用Ipconfig設(shè)置DNS
直接在命令提示符下執(zhí)行Ipconfig命令可以查看DNS服務(wù)器的配置情況(圖1)。該命令還可以手工更新一個(gè)客戶的DNS注冊,排除DNS名稱注冊失敗的故障,或?qū)NS服務(wù)器動(dòng)態(tài)更新故障。使用命令I(lǐng)pconfig registerdns可以更新或排除一個(gè)客戶的DNS注冊故障,因?yàn)樵撁顚⑺⑿翫HCP的租約并注冊計(jì)算機(jī)的主機(jī)名。

四、使用Nslookup診斷
Nslookup是診斷DNS的實(shí)用程序,它答應(yīng)與DNS以對話方式工作并讓用戶檢查資源記錄,它也在命令行上運(yùn)行,語法如下:
Nslookup -optionhostname server
-option指定一個(gè)或多個(gè)命令行選項(xiàng)。例如要列出命令清單。
Hostname:使用用戶指定的主機(jī)名,缺省使用用戶指定的服務(wù)器。
Server:使用用戶指定的DNS服務(wù)器,缺省指定使用在TCP/IP網(wǎng)絡(luò)配置中指定的DNS服務(wù)器。
例如,命令Nslookup -querytype=mx kwsoffice.com可以顯示kwsoffice.com的郵件交換信息(圖2)。此外,Nslookup還有其它功能,如檢查一個(gè)區(qū)域內(nèi)的資源記錄、檢查是否回應(yīng)請求。例如,執(zhí)行Nslookup 192.168.12.1 127.0.0.1該命令第一個(gè)IP地址是DNS服務(wù)器。假如服務(wù)器回應(yīng)就顯示“l(fā)ocalhost”。

當(dāng)然,它還能檢查DC是否使用SVR資源記錄添加一個(gè)區(qū)域、測試來自Wins的回應(yīng)等,這些在命令的幫助信息中都有,好好看看能有不少新的發(fā)現(xiàn)。
注重: 執(zhí)行Nslookup后,系統(tǒng)提示符將變成“>”形式,表示已經(jīng)進(jìn)入對話方式,直接鍵入HELP可以看到所有可用命令,鍵入EXIT可以退出返回到DOS命令提示符下如圖3所示。

五、查看Logging日志了解DNS工作狀況
DNS治理器答應(yīng)用戶配置附加的日志選項(xiàng),內(nèi)容包括:查詢、通知、應(yīng)答、UDP、TCP、完整數(shù)據(jù)包、寫入等。要建立DNS記錄,在DNS服務(wù)器上單擊右鍵,選擇“屬性”、“日志”即可,你可以看到下面提示的日志文件的名稱和位置(圖4)。

使用Logging可以調(diào)試注冊、查詢并提供DNS的統(tǒng)計(jì)信息和計(jì)劃DNS服務(wù)器的利用能力,以此來幫助排除解析故障
六、通過DNS治理器監(jiān)視
采用DNS治理器可以監(jiān)視和測試DNS服務(wù)。在DNS服務(wù)器上單擊右鍵,選擇“屬性”、“監(jiān)視”、“立即測試”即可測試DNS。測試包括兩方面的內(nèi)容:
簡單查詢:查詢測試DNS服務(wù)器正向搜索(映射一個(gè)IP地址的名稱)的能力。
遞進(jìn)查詢:查詢測試DNS服務(wù)器反向搜索(映射一個(gè)名稱的IP地址)的能力。
測試結(jié)果就在窗口中,以“通過”或“失敗”“論英雄”(圖5)。你還可以設(shè)置一定的時(shí)間間隔內(nèi)的自動(dòng)DNS查詢測試,這在建立DNS初期很有實(shí)際意義。

新聞熱點(diǎn)
疑難解答
圖片精選